Abstract

En este artículo recopilaremos las fuentes gráficas y escritas que desde la Edad Media hasta bien entrado el siglo XX, se conservan acerca del anfiteatro de Itálica. Iniciaremos este recorrido comentando las primeras descripciones en las que se dejaba entrever la escasa relevancia del edificio, para finalizar con un análisis tanto de los resultados obtenidos en las excavaciones arqueológicas que se han ido efectuando, como de la progresiva importancia que ha ido adquiriendo durante las últimas centurias. Del mismo modo, haremos alusión a los principales motivos de su deterioro, fundamentalmente la extracción de su fábrica para la realización de otras construcciones, además de las causas que motivaron su abandono, y la falta de mantenimiento que ha presentado durante siglos.
